Type
ORACLE
Validation date
2024-04-02 07:22: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03441,
    "usd": 0.03692
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001874B41D2DDCAF1BA920220068F9E213C0CE4B0C26C32941BD551B3B9453ECB3E

Previous signature

9BC2FF885A6597A1E998B5B025E5467C0DB5221722AE1B019FAEB336E34232ACE8D6DB48893E94A7848011264F6F2979D61CC22AC0FC0915F9DAF823F2BF7301

Origin signature

3045022100EFD43773A43960F617EFB014F45831FD4CA5708B0BDC76FACCBD469CFA4398B602206EDF1ADD1B2619317B45205C5426FC14E13F27CDAC06FB1B3DCE5842E31267DD

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

001253D30869633CCA58E92A1C21B90FDCB8767D51EA838D8400CF9E0CC5C5B151

Coordinator signature

600DE1706FCF20CE5A2DE1400140C2F3F53E023A39CA1276A556C80A19322DA6BFD07E283E1D9C83E996A87B51BDACF1F35A1E4C15DFCC1EF47F754F2850460C

Validator #1 public key

000103E30584AD8DE66F9E29419D5D0ABEE5A76722C9FD0D012BDDE3A6E2B149C48D

Validator #1 signature

1AC0298B30DC7CF053C9A12209A2D70FDA9CF7E634EAF3A04844EDAA9166754340532E2E97FE19E8FB7A067353B3BAFFB6F1BD2FDE85FB80D7F2C9E7F9C48409

Validator #2 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#2 signature

3E20179EC856B9816EB227D77A338EBFD9AD4B081053800CA26CD61AAD4F9FFE086EE1E2A1280CC5EDDBE51BCB5149E89E462ECDD5818FA36AC60347752DC50A